Wanda Lou Ritch Lowery, 81, of Van Buren, went home to our Lord on Saturday, December 16, 2023 at her home, after a long battle with Parkinson's disease. She was born April 10, 1942 in Fayetteville to the late Andrew and Susie (Guist) Ritch. Wanda received her education from Fayetteville Public Schools. Following her studies there, she went to work in food services at the University of Arkansas's Brough Commons Dining Hall. Her time at Brough Commons helped expand her culinary skills and made her a wonderful cook, an excellent service provider, and allowed her the opportunity to meet wonderful people from all walks of life.
At the tender age of 21, Wanda met and married Less Lowery of Van Buren. The two made their home in Van Buren and raised three beautiful children; Debbie, Melissa and Terrel. Life wasn't always easy, but Wanda was a proud homemaker and she worked very hard to make sure that her household was always clean and well organized, and that there were always good meals on the table for her family, while her husband Less worked to provide for them. As a stay-at-home mother, she taught her children the importance of serving our Lord, Jesus, and went to church faithfully at the Free Will Baptist Church under Pastor Keith Hatton.
Wanda loved the Lord. She was well known for always singing songs of praise and worship both at church and in her everyday life. Wanda also led family prayer sessions at gatherings and ministered to anyone and everyone who would listen. Wanda was at her best when she was involved in leading others to the Lord and calling them to worship at church. Not only was she a faithful servant to her Lord and church, she also served her community by volunteering to sing in area Nursing Homes along with her husband Less. The two enjoyed many other activities together, like going for long car rides, enjoying nature and visiting their family members who are spread out in the northwest Arkansas area. Their favorite activity, though, was going to garage sales and estate sales, where they amassed a treasure trove of antiques and collectibles.
In addition to her parents, she was preceded in death by her oldest daughter, Debbie; her sisters, Peggy Mowery, Thelma Sager, Margaret Ritch, and Sis Ritch; her brothers, Orville Ritch and Cotton Ritch; a niece, Susie Ritch; and a nephew, Jason Cronn.
She leaves behind her husband of 60 years, Less Lowery; a daughter, Melissa Andrews and husband Dan; a son, Terrell Lowery and wife Lisa; her sisters, Mary Mitchell, Linda Stamps, and Vera Jackson; her brothers, Ricky Ritch and Jackie Ritch; five beloved grandchildren, and nine great-grandchildren.
